Juan Lang : oleaut32: Constify input parameter to VarR8FromDec.

Alexandre Julliard julliard at winehq.org
Thu Feb 19 09:18:27 CST 2009


Module: wine
Branch: master
Commit: d693dfda8c1a96c109929cc39f550fc8cefe4f0f
URL:    http://source.winehq.org/git/wine.git/?a=commit;h=d693dfda8c1a96c109929cc39f550fc8cefe4f0f

Author: Juan Lang <juan.lang at gmail.com>
Date:   Wed Feb 18 09:05:01 2009 -0800

oleaut32: Constify input parameter to VarR8FromDec.

With thanks to Dmitry for spotting this.

---

 dlls/oleaut32/vartype.c |    2 +-
 include/oleauto.h       |    2 +-
 2 files changed, 2 insertions(+), 2 deletions(-)

diff --git a/dlls/oleaut32/vartype.c b/dlls/oleaut32/vartype.c
index 77c2d14..3e435ab 100644
--- a/dlls/oleaut32/vartype.c
+++ b/dlls/oleaut32/vartype.c
@@ -3265,7 +3265,7 @@ HRESULT WINAPI VarR8FromUI4(ULONG ulIn, double *pDblOut)
  *  Success: S_OK.
  *  Failure: E_INVALIDARG, if the source value is invalid.
  */
-HRESULT WINAPI VarR8FromDec(DECIMAL* pDecIn, double *pDblOut)
+HRESULT WINAPI VarR8FromDec(const DECIMAL* pDecIn, double *pDblOut)
 {
   BYTE scale = DEC_SCALE(pDecIn);
   double divisor = 1.0, highPart;
diff --git a/include/oleauto.h b/include/oleauto.h
index 4492d04..98e8dbf 100644
--- a/include/oleauto.h
+++ b/include/oleauto.h
@@ -316,7 +316,7 @@ HRESULT WINAPI VarR8FromUI4(ULONG,double*);
 HRESULT WINAPI VarR8FromUI8(ULONG64,double*);
 HRESULT WINAPI VarR8FromStr(OLECHAR*,LCID,ULONG,double*);
 HRESULT WINAPI VarR8FromCy(CY,double*);
-HRESULT WINAPI VarR8FromDec(DECIMAL*,double*);
+HRESULT WINAPI VarR8FromDec(const DECIMAL*,double*);
 HRESULT WINAPI VarR8FromDisp(IDispatch*,LCID,double*);
 
 HRESULT WINAPI VarDateFromUI1(BYTE,DATE*);




More information about the wine-cvs mailing list